Force Protection Europe (FPE) is the British defence company which developed the Ocelot (also known as Foxhound) light-weight mine-protected military vehicle.[2]
FPE won a £180 million contract from the British Ministry of Defence in 2010 to supply 200 of the Ocelot vehicles, which has been developed to replace the Snatch Land Rover.[2]
FPE was acquired by General Dynamics in December 2011. [3] The Ocelot is now marketed as part of General Dynamics Land Systems vehicle portfolio.[4]
